2. Call the Authorities
Inform the authorities about the break-in. They will document the event, which is important for insurance coverage claims and any prospective examinations.
3. Document the Damage
Take photographs of any damage to your property. This paperwork will be helpful for insurance coverage functions and for the cops report.

5. Contact Your Insurance Company
Alert your insurance provider about the incident to begin the claims process. They may require a police report and documentation of your losses.

A: It's advisable to address damages as soon as possible to restore security and avoid further concerns.
Q: Will insurance cover all repair costs?
A: It depends on your particular policy; numerous policies cover repair costs connected to break-ins, so contact your company.
Q: What if I discover surprise damage after the initial repair?
A: Examine your home completely after the preliminary repairs. If you discover hidden damage, call your insurance provider and a professional for a second evaluation.
Q: Should I handle repairs myself?
A: While minor repairs can typically be handled by property owners, significant damage must be managed by experts to guarantee security and compliance with local building codes.
